Description
TAF11L12 is a pseudogene derived from the TAF11 gene, located on chromosome 5q35.3. It is transcribed into a long non-coding RNA (lncRNA) but is not translated into a functional protein. The gene is part of the TAF11-like family, which includes multiple pseudogenes across the genome. Although its exact function is not fully characterized, pseudogene-derived lncRNAs can regulate their parental genes or other genes through mechanisms such as microRNA sponging or chromatin remodeling. TAF11L12 is expressed at low levels in various tissues, and its dysregulation has been implicated in certain cancers, though evidence is limited.
